Photonics Market To Generate $1,214.5 Billion Revenue by 2030


The rising need for energy-efficient products and increasing deployment of the photonics technology in communication applications will help the photonics market grow at a CAGR of 6.9% during the forecast period (2020–2030). According to P&S Intelligence, the market was valued at $576.8 billion in 2019, and it is projected to generate $1,214.5 billion revenue in 2030. Besides, the escalating demand for electronic products, such as smartphones, tablets, wearable devices, and laptops, will contribute to the market growth globally.

The burgeoning demand for energy-efficient products is one of the key growth drivers for the market, as such products help in reducing the fossil fuel consumption at power plants and operate efficiently for long hours at low maintenance costs. As a result of these advantages, energy efficiency has become a prominent parameter in the development of high-performance computing systems. Moreover, the photonics technology is being extensively used in the production of solar modules, as governments across the world are encouraging the establishment of solar power plants.

Moreover, the increasing adoption of light in communication applications will supplement the photonics market growth in the upcoming years. For instance, data centers are increasingly deploying silicon photonic instruments to develop high-speed transmission systems, as these instruments provide high data transfer rates and consume lesser power. Additionally, the increasing focus of Datacom protocols on high-speed signaling is boosting the demand for photonics products and reducing the deployment of copper-based optical cables.

The product type segment of the photonics market is categorized into light-emitting diode (LED), laser, sensor and detector, and optical component and system. Under this segment, the LED category is expected to exhibit the fastest growth during the forecast period due to the increasing adoption of the LED technology to conserve electricity. This technology is being integrated into intelligent digital lighting solutions to reduce energy consumption by around 70%. Moreover, the greater lifespan of LED lights contributes to the growth of this category.
